1. 前言 本文是“Linux内核分析”系列文章的第一篇,会以内核的核心功能为出发点,描述Linux内核的整体架构,以及架构之下主要的软件子系统。之后,会介绍Linux内核源文件的目录结构,并和各个软件子系统对应。 注&#…
2025/2/19 7:00:15 人评论 次浏览上一篇说了函数的基本构成,这次说下自定义函数的一些常见处理。 目录 一、参数位置 二、关键字参数 三、设定默认值 四、不定长参数 一、参数位置 在对自定义函数传参时有时候希望传一个参数,有时候希望传递多个参数,有时候也有可能传默…
2025/2/18 22:33:22 人评论 次浏览1. 模型整体架构图: 显然,一个编码器-解码器架构。先不考虑batch_sizes,编码器将输入的序列(L,d)编码为(L, d_model),d_model 为设置的参数表示将输入嵌入到多少维度。 编码器输入为…
2025/2/18 10:47:51 人评论 次浏览描述BIO 阻塞式IO,采用传统的java IO进行操作,该模式下每个请求都会创建一个线程, 适用于并发量小的场景 NIO同步非阻塞,比传统BIO能更好的支持大并发,tomcat 8.0 后默认采用该模式APRtomcat 以JNI形式调用http服务器的…
2025/2/18 9:59:12 人评论 次浏览客制化机械键盘最大的好处就是布局可以随心定制,这一点在方向键处理上绝对是解决了我的使用痛点,详情可见 macOS下玩转机械键盘总结——硬件篇 之第四阶段键位功能调整。但仅在板级上做定制还不够,macOS下有一些外接键盘的坑依然需要软件手段…
2025/2/19 7:09:52 人评论 次浏览文章目录1. 综述2. 消息队列(Message Queue)2.1 点对点2.2 发布/订阅(pub-sub)3. Kafka基础术语解释3.1 Broker3.2 Partitions3.3 Message4. Kafka持久化5. Kafka 作为消息/存储系统及流处理5.1 消息系统5.2 存储系统5.3 流处理6. 常用配置项6.1 Kafka实例配置6.1.1 broker配置…
2025/2/19 7:08:46 人评论 次浏览Spring Boot 集成 easypoi实现excel的多sheet导入导出 一、excel多sheet导入 1.导入依赖 <!--easypoi依赖,实现excel文件导入导出--> <dependency><groupId>cn.afterturn</groupId><artifactId>easypoi-spring-boot-starter</a…
2025/2/19 7:07:37 人评论 次浏览由于客户需求,所以进行对文章的arclist标签进行设置当前样式(currentstyle),修改前记得备份。dede版本v5.7sp找到PHP修改:include/taglib/arclist.lib.php1、搜索:$channelid $ctag->GetAtt(‘channelid’);在下面插入:$currentstyle $ctag->Get…
2025/2/19 7:06:34 人评论 次浏览spl_autoload_register — 注册给定的函数作为 __autoload 的实现 bool spl_autoload_register ([ callable $autoload_function [, bool $throw true [, bool $prepend false ]]] ) 参数autoload_function 欲注册的自动装载函数。如果没有提供任何参数,则自动注册…
2025/2/19 7:05:32 人评论 次浏览题目链接:http://www.spoj.pl/problems/PHRASES/ 题目思路:二分答案,然后分组,看一组中是否包含所有字符串,且每个字符串出现两次及两次以上,然后距离差大于等于k。 #include<stdio.h> #include<…
2025/2/19 7:04:26 人评论 次浏览1.数据类型 1)虽然clickhouse底层将DateTime存储为时间戳Long类型,但不建议直接存储Long类型,因为DateTime不需要经过函数转换处理,执行效率高、可读性好。 2)官方已经指出Nullable类型几乎总是会拖累性能࿰…
2025/1/21 22:47:37 人评论 次浏览sdnuoj1251题目链接比赛的时候混淆了博弈论的规则,感觉这个题的规则不伦不类的,又像威佐夫博弈又像尼姆博弈的,没想到真的是这个样子,比赛的时候题目中第二个规则的最后一条没有看到,还有就是没有用到素数的提示&#…
2025/1/23 10:15:01 人评论 次浏览班级: 数学101软件 学号:201012010225姓名: 田贵文 实验组别:实验日期: 报告日期: 成绩:报告内容:(目的和要求、原理、步骤、数据、计算、小结等)实验名称:C语言编程二…
2025/1/26 21:14:41 人评论 次浏览一边整理资料,一边学习这些基本概念,这时间花的值。 概念中文描述commit提交Action that ends a database transaction and makes permanent all changes performed in the transaction.commit cleanout提交清除The automatic removal of lock-related …
2025/1/24 21:46:32 人评论 次浏览1. 常规解析方法 //懒加载声明一个LJNewsModel为数据的数组 lazy var ljArray : [LJNewsModel] [LJNewsModel]() //MARK:-- 数据获取和解析 extension NewsViewController{func requestNetData(){/*打印json数据*/LJDownLoadNetImage.request("GET", url: "htt…
2025/2/12 6:39:28 人评论 次浏览本文主要内容摘自《数学建模算法与应用》以及网上各类博客 模拟退火算法 算法简介 模拟退火算法得益于材料的统计力学的研究成果。统计力学表明材料中粒子的不同结构对应于粒子的不同能量水平。在高温条件下,粒子的能量较高,可以自由运动和重新排列。在…
2025/2/7 8:13:52 人评论 次浏览